Re: AQ131A sea water pump bushings
The one in the body pushes out easy.
The one in the cover...
I took a phillips screwdriver and ground down one of the four "tabs"
Used it and small hammer to start beating an edge INTO the cover.
The bushing was brittle and started to chip apart.
One it started brekaing up, I got a large diameter bolt tap and screwed it in part way.
I'm thinking it was a 1/2 pipe thread tap.
Got it looser and pulled out while turning.
You have to support the cover very good to prevent bending or braking it during the entire evolution.
The pump works better, but the body is worn down allowing water to pass around the ends of the impeller blades.
So buying a new pump might have been a better (but not cheaper) way to go.
